Transaction 08830c5a685409c9b97dc169b86fb38352231704e846c90d8a722fedd68b303f
1 Input
1 Output
-
08830c5a685409c9b97dc169b86fb38352231704e846c90d8a722fedd68b303f:0
- value
- 44434
- script pubkey
- OP_0 OP_PUSHBYTES_20 c986da0d14772bd8a2ec446e5796726bdfdf671b
- address
- bc1qexrd5rg5wu4a3ghvg3h909njd00a7ecmdkd6hf